About

Camtec Photo is a shop entirely devoted to photography, serving Montreal for more than forty years. You'll find a carefully chosen selection of cameras and equipment, alongside a professional photo lab known for the quality of its work and its personal service. Digital or film, first camera or specialist gear, you'll be met with attention and the time you need.

Our team brings decades of practice to photographers of every level. Through our newsletter, our workshops and the artists we showcase, we want to remain a Montreal fixture for everyone who loves fine cameras and photography.

Jean

A devoted photographer, Jean took over Place Victoria Cameras in 1981 before founding Camtec Photo on Notre-Dame Street in 1988, uniting a specialized boutique and professional lab under one roof. Over the decades, he has made Camtec a landmark of the Quebec and Canadian photographic community, championing photography as an art form through initiatives like the M Vision workshops. A beloved figure on the local scene, he is synonymous with Leica in this country and remains very much at the heart of the shop.

Founder of Camtec Photo
